An electrical fault detection device (10) installed in a vehicle ensures detection accuracy while avoiding the use of expensive components and suppressing total costs. The vehicle includes a power storage unit (20) that is installed as insulated from a chassis ground of the vehicle, a first switch (MRp) that is inserted into a plus line (Lp), and a second switch (MRm) that is inserted into a minus line (Lm). The electrical fault detection device (10) installed in the vehicle includes a coupling capacitor (Cc), an AC output unit (13a), a first voltage measurement unit (13b), a first determination unit (13c), a voltage-dividing circuit (11), a second voltage measurement unit (12), and a second determination unit (13d). The voltage-dividing circuit (11) connects between the plus line (Lp) that is between the first switch (MRp) and one end of a load (2), and the minus line (Lm) that is between the second switch (MRm) and the other end of the load (2).
